“The one question I ask every roofing client that nobody else asks: what's your attic ventilation situation? In LA, an unventilated attic adds 15–20°F to your home's interior temperature and significantly shortens shingle life. Before we replace a roof, we assess the ridge and soffit venting and fix it if it's inadequate. It adds $800 and makes the roof last 5–8 years longer.”

Pro Tip

Verify drip edge specification before signing any roofing contract. Drip edge is a metal flashing that goes along the eaves and rakes before the underlayment. It's code-required and frequently omitted by budget contractors. Without drip edge, water enters behind the fascia during wind-driven rain events.

Roofing in Beverly Hills: Local Context

Roofing projects in Beverly Hills run against a specific housing stock: 1920s-2020s, mixed (Spanish Colonial to ultra-modern). Expected project cost in Beverly Hills: $12,400–$77,500 based on our LA base range ($8,000–$50,000) multiplied by the Beverly Hills cost coefficient (1.55×).

Re-roofs in this neighborhood's housing stock almost always trigger structural upgrade when converting from original wood shake to Class A composition or tile, and all roofs in LA require cool-roof reflectance compliance per Title 24 climate zone 6.

In VHFHSZ parcels only Class A roofing assemblies are permitted, and eaves require 1-hour-rated soffit assemblies.
